Output 68f7e94ee236d8ebf4ae01d54d26066fe8df79f17eb9d88d559d416ade5978b4:0

value
50117789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d332fb38ed7f2b3dcf36cfc78d464e0a5dcedb9 OP_EQUAL
address
3EZcX5dZTFFq4rGmVczCmpf442PGnHkTbV
transaction
68f7e94ee236d8ebf4ae01d54d26066fe8df79f17eb9d88d559d416ade5978b4
spent
true